Abstract :
Versatile Power Supply (VPS) Control is a component of a network-based control system and SCADA software with a client/server architecture developed using the Datalogging and Supervisory Control (DSC) by National Instruments. Installing OLE for Process Control (OPC) in the data server of VPS allows access to every kind of CAEN power supply (SY1527, SY527, etc.) that supports OPC server functionality and achieves integration of data and operation. Using VPS Graphic Panels, graphical menus with various data presentations have been created, so a new CAEN modules can be added without writing new code but only extending the Citadel Data Base. The data acquired to the Data Base server are accessible from the network.
